Abstract
The Chinese tallow tree is one of the four major woody oil trees in China. The method of preparing biodiesel from Chinese tallow kernel oil was studied by nanometer magnetic solid catalyst. Central combination design method was applied to design the experiment and the optimal esterification ratio is 96.78%. The biodiesel mainly contains fatty acid ester of C16:0, C18:0, C18:1, C18:2, C18:3, determined by Gaseous phase chromatogram.
